What does Boeing do in Houston?
With more than 2,500 employees, the Houston site serves as the official headquarters for Boeing Space Exploration, which includes Boeing’s Constellation, International Space Station and Space Shuttle programs. Combat Systems, Global Services & Support, and Boeing Research & Technology are also represented at the site.

Does Boeing have a plant in Texas?
Boeing has picked offices at the 255-acre Legacy West development in Plano, Texas, as the headquarters for its new Boeing Global Services unit, citing its central location within Boeing’s U.S. footprint and proximity to major operations of its commercial airline customers and defense partners.

Where is Boeing Texas?
Boeing San Antonio continues the legacy of aviation as an anchor tenant for Port San Antonio. The company utilizes over 1.6 million square feet of enclosed area, including 940,000 square feet of hangar space along with 3.5 million square feet of aircraft ramps, run-up areas, and parking pads.

Does Boeing pay for housing?
While Boeing has long offered a housing stipend and search assistance, the company this year also began offering managed housing, and about 20 percent of its 1,000 Seattle-area interns have chosen that option. Boeing contracts with Altair Global Relocation to furnish its apartments.
Is Boeing pension for life?
Boeing offers many employees the option at retirement to either receive a pension, providing monthly income for life, or to have a single lump sum deposited into a retirement account that can be invested and withdrawn as desired.
